“Bike Killer” Translator-Curator Sam Kandej in Conversation with Contributor Mitchell Toews Sam Kandej of Iran asks English language author Mitchell Toews of Canada SIX QUESTIONS about writing. Mitch is the author of Pinching Zwieback (At Bay Press, 2023). He has a novel (also with Winnipeg's At Bay Press) forthcoming this spring and a second collection will be introduced later in 2026, on Canada's west coast. Mitch has a considerable periodical footprint with well over 150 publications in Canada, the US, the UK and elsewhere around the world. The recipient of a Journey Prize nomination and four Pushcart Prize nominations, Mitch has been writing professionally since 2016.

Iranian Author, Translator, Curator Sam Kandej Writer friend Sam Kandej has a "top five" story on the venerable site, Fiction on the Web. Here is his BIO: Hello! My name is Maysam Najafi Kandej, but I prefer to be called Sam Kandej in English. I was born on October 6th, 1988, in Tehran, while my mother was only seventeen. As Iran is a vast country home to people of different races, languages, and religions, I’d like you to know that I’m a dark-skinned Persian Muslim, grown up in a relatively poor but respectable family.
